Search on the Diagnosing Method for the Change of Rotating and Stationary Parts Clearance in Steam Turbine
This paper addresses the diagnosis of change in clearance between the rotating and stationary parts clearance in Steam Turbine. In this paper, the statistics of change in clearance between the rotating and stationary parts of Steam Turbine is done firstly. Then the changing characteristics of pressure ratio of stage groups are analyzed, it is found that the pressure ratio values are not changed with the change of main steam flow rate under the normal state of steam flow path. As the clearances are increased, the pressure ratio will be increased with the same main steam flow rate. Taking account of the influences of the change in steam temperature and auxiliary steam on pressure ratio of stage groups, the diagnosis criterion is given. Diagnosing results in a 300MW steam turbine show the method is effective. The diagnosing method has guided significantly for opening cylinder for overhaul of steam turbine.
